This cache is a match holder size container. Please rehide in the same manner as it is hidden.
Cache is located by Pulpit Rock, which is in the Will Baker Park and near the Decorah Campground.
You'll find the cache only after reaching the viewing platform that is above Pulpit Rock. The climb from parking is short, and is a combination of well defined steps carved through the limestone cliff and some weather-worn rock steps.
During the winter months, be careful of ice and snow on the steps.
The actual cache can be found while on the viewing platform. No need to climb over, reach over, or search on the other side of the limestone wall.
Some Pulpit Rock information copied from "Decorah Trail and Trolls" by G.E. Knudson.
This isolated pillar of rock is the result of erosion which gradually weathered and enlarged a crack in the original Galena limestone. The rock also moved slightly outward on the soft and slippery Decorah shale on which it rests. It is good evidence that this area escaped recent glaciation.
